Ferencvaros Budapest – Statistics & current form

This summer, Ferencvaros Budapest secured the national championship in Hungary for the 31st time. For the second time in a row, the Zöld Sasok (in German: the green eagles) were at the top and this time, for the first time in 25 years, they successfully qualified for the group stage of the Champions League.

For this, the Hungarians had to defeat four very demanding national champions in the qualifying rounds with Djurgardens IF, Celtic Glasgow, Dinamo Zagreb and FK Molde, which Sergiy Rebrov’s team also managed.

One point from the first two group games

So far, however, the Zölt Sasok have not been able to build on their strong performances in the qualifying rounds. Away in Barcelona, there was absolutely nothing to gain for the underdogs before the defeat at home could only be averted against Dynamo Kyiv with a last-minute goal.

Because of the 2-2, the Hungarians are at least theoretically still in the race. With a home win over Juventus Turin, they could also climb to second place in the Group G table. Of course, that’s not really likely.

In the Champions League group stage without a home win

This is not surprising, as the Hungarians have never before won a home game in the group stage of the Champions League (three draws, one defeat). The fact that the dress rehearsal at Fehervar FC failed in a 1-1 draw at the national level at the weekend doesn’t exactly increase the chances.

Juventus – Statistics & current form

The 2020/21 season is still very double-edged for Juventus Turin. On the one hand, the Bianconeri, who recently celebrated nine national championships in a row, are still unbeaten in the league after six games.

On the other hand, the home game against Naples, won 3-0 at the green table, could lead to a catch-up game. Of the five games played, three games ended only in a draw. Including the games against underdogs like Crotone and Hellas Verona.

In 17 of 21 group stages, Juve qualified for the round of 16

Meanwhile, the Zebre started in the premier class with a 2-0 away win in Kiev and thus solved the first mandatory task, last week there was the next setback at home against a troubled FC Barcelona. Andrea Pirolo’s men lost 2-0 at home to the Catalans.

This means that the Bianconeri in Hungary are now under pressure and have to get the three at Ferencvaros so that there are no doubts about reaching the round of 16. In 17 of the last 21 participations in the preliminary round, the Italians finally continued in the knockout round.
